## Runbook: Gaugepile Sidecar — Release Checklist

Heads up: the sidecar ships with every app pod, so a bad config fans out fast. Before cutting a release, confirm the flush interval hasn't drifted from what the Tallyhouse aggregator expects, or you'll see sawtooth gaps in dashboards. Rollbacks are cheap — just repin the image tag. Canary one node pool first, watch for ten minutes, then proceed. The values to verify against are these.

config for bagep-yafof:
quenath:
  pin: 8584
  metrics_host: metrics.quenath.tolvaqsys.internal
  tenant: pelath
  seal: seal_ed102645

# Runbook: Hunting leaked file descriptors in Quillgate

When the `fd_open` gauge climbs steadily between deploys, suspect a leak rather than load. First confirm on a single pod: exec in and count entries under `/proc/1/fd`, noting how many are sockets in CLOSE_WAIT versus regular files. Capture two snapshots ten minutes apart before restarting anything — we need the delta for the postmortem. Reproduce locally with the Marbury load harness, which requires the service running with the following configuration values.

settings of yagep-bajog:
[istdor]
port = 4000
region = south-2
host = istdor.qorvelcorp.internal
timeout_ms = 5000
retries = 5

ALERT: RestockPlan stale-route warning. Fires when the Snackline vending restock planner hasn't generated fresh routes in 6 hours. Usually means the depot inventory feed from Cravex stalled. New folks: check the planner's ingest log first, then restart the feed worker if the last heartbeat is old. Do not clear the queue manually. If it refires within an hour, escalate by mail.

escalation mailbox, bafog-fafog: ulador@paliqlabs.internal

## TICKET-1142: Signature check failing on ReminderSpool deploy

Heads up, new folks — this one bites everyone eventually. The clinic appointment reminder job failed its signature check on last night's deploy and the Carillon scheduler refused the image. Turns out the pipeline was still signing with the retired key from the spring rotation. Fix: update the signer config and re-run the publish stage. So nobody has to dig through the vault again, the current key is:

signing key of tafop-yaduf = bky4_uj3Z